Abstract

A method and system are disclosed for remotely storing information for initializing a configurable network device at a direct server in the network. The information for initializing the configurable network device is automatically retrieved and used by the network device to self-initialize after the network address of the directory server is provided. Included in the information in some embodiments are the network addresses of a policy server and an authentication server, thereby allowing the network device to automatically retrieve policy information and authentication information as needed. Remote storage of substantially all information used to setup and run the network device substantially reduces the effort needed to backup or change information for large distributed networks including numerous configurable network devices.

Claims (45)

1. An automated setup method in a first configurable network device (CND) associated with device-specific setup information (DSSI), the CND operably coupled to a distributed network comprising a DSSI server having a DSSI server identifier, a policy server having a policy server identifier, and an authentication server having an authentication server identifier, the method comprising the steps of:

storing the DSSI at the DSSI server, the DSSI comprising the policy server identifier and the authentication server identifier;

storing policy information for the CND at the policy server;

storing authentication information for the CND at the authentication server;

retrieving the DSSI for the CND from the DSSI server, wherein the DSSI includes a DSSI server identifier associated with the DSSI server, wherein retrieving the DSSI is performed using the DSSI server identifier, and wherein the DSSI includes system settings, chassis and interface settings, Internet Protocol routing information, device-specific setup (DSS) policy information, DSS authorization and security settings, accounting settings, simple network management protocol, server load balancing properties, web accesses. properties, domain name service, group mobility advertisement protocol, virtual local area network advertisement Protocol, and asynchronous transfer mode setup information;

determining that a shared resource server (SRS) having shared resource information (SRI) stored thereon is accessible by the CND, wherein said SRI is accessible from the SRS by the DSSI server dependent upon a SRS identifier included in the DSSI;

retrieving the SRI for the CND from the SRS thereby causing a local copy of the SRI and the DSSI to be retained at the CND;

repeating the DSSI retrieving step one or more times while the CND is in a standard operational state in response to determining that the SRS is not accessible by the CND;

caching the DSSI acquired in the retrieving step in a CND memory; and

determining whether or not the SRS is accessible includes determining if the DSSI includes an identifier corresponding to the SRS; and

after the step of retrieving the associated DSSI, determining whether the current DSSI server identifier retrieved from the DSSI server is different than a previous DSSI server identifier retained in CND memory and retrieving DSSI from the DSSI server using the current DSSI server identifier retrieved if different than the previous DSSI server identifier.

2. The automated setup method of claim 1 , wherein the step of retrieving occurs automatically upon initialization and boot-up of the CND.

3. The automated setup method of claim 2 , wherein the method further includes the step of retrieving policy information from the policy server using the policy server identifier retrieved from the DSSI server.

4. The automated setup method of claim 3 , wherein substantially all the policy information is automatically retrieved at initialization and boot-up.

5. The automated setup method of claim 3 , wherein the policy server identifier is a network address.

6. The automated setup method of claim 2 , wherein the method further includes the step of retrieving authentication information from the authentication server using the authentication server identifier retrieved from the DSSI server.

7. The automated setup method of claim 6 , wherein substantially all the authentication information is automatically retrieved at initialization and boot-up.

8. The automated setup method of claim 6 , wherein the authentication server identifier is a network address.

9. The automated setup method in claim 1 , wherein the CND is a multi-layer switching device.
